Western Digitals ShareSpace

Today's modern SoHo Office and Small Business users are always looking for modes in how to save their precious files in Back-Up incase that horrible event should ever transpire - a hard disc failure.  There are many options out in the wild and the bigger you get with more added functionality within the Back-Up device, the more expensive they become.   Its not often that we see end users spending in excessive of easily £1500 for  simple device with the associated back-up software.   With "credit crunch" being the vogue phrase of today and it is hitting some companies very hard, we have to look for a device that will facilitate all the back-up needs of the one.   Enter the Western Digital ShareSpace.  This is an exceptional piece of equipment that after looking at the basic facts below will have many thinking - this is the way to go.

This high-speed network-attached storage system with capacities up to 4 TB and a space-saving footprint gives you all the benefits of a big time data centre without the need for a big time IT department. Perfect for centralizing and sharing data on a small office or home network.

Key Features

Big capacity, small footprint - Offered in 2 and 4 TB capacities, this small-footprint four-bay system takes up very little space and provides plenty of storage to go around.

RAID capability - Offers multiple RAID configurations for data protection and speed -- RAID 0 (Striped), RAID 1 (Mirrored) and RAID 5. The RAID 5 mode, only available on the fully-populated 4-drive system, is the recommended mode to achieve both high-performance and data protection through redundancy.

The 4 TB WD ShareSpace system is shipped in RAID 5 mode for maximum reliability.

The 2 TB WD ShareSpace system is shipped in Spanning Mode for maximum capacity and the flexibility to add additional drives without reformatting the system.

High-speed access, Ethernet connectivity - Provides data transfer rates up to 1000 Mbit/s when used in a GigE network.

Gigabit networking and transfer rates are five to six times faster than other network storage systems. This performance is comparable to USB 2.0 direct-attached storage.

Easy setup and discovery - An intuitive set-up wizard and easy-to-use discovery tool makes installation a snap.

E-mail alert system - Monitors drive and system health and sends you an e-mail if a problem is detected.

Microsoft Active Directory support - Will join an Active Directory domain to utilize AD users and groups.

Push-button transfer - Plug a USB drive into the front-mounted USB 2.0 port and push a button to automatically transfer all the data on the drive to the WD ShareSpace system.

Automatic network backup software - Set up continuous backup for the computers* in your network using the included automatic backup software. Select the files you want to back up, then set it and forget it; every time you save a change it's automatically backed up. *3 software licenses included.

Remote access software - Access your files anywhere, anytime using MioNet® remote access services from WD.

Download manager - Supports scheduled download through FTP and HTTP. Simultaneously manage multiple download tasks.

iTunes® server support - Centralize your music collection and stream to a Mac® or Windows® PC using iTunes software.

Windows Vista® ready - Works seamlessly with Windows Vista to provide easy setup and automatic discovery.

Built-in FTP server - Set up your own FTP server. Manage the access authority and share your files with your friends or customers easily.

Three USB 2.0 ports - Two USB ports on the back to connect additional USB hard drives for backup or additional network storage. One USB port on the front for push button transfer.

  

Cooler, quieter, eco-friendlier - Equipped with WD drives using WD GreenPower™ technology, this system, with its efficient cooling architecture, and power saving mode, consumes up to 33% less power**, is reliably cool, and remarkably quiet.

** Tests based on comparison between a 1 TB dual-drive system using 7200 RPM drives and a 1 TB dual-drive system using WD’s GreenPower drives.

Network storage manager - Manage your system configuration, create user IDs, passwords, security permissions, and quotas. 

Ideal For

For small workgroups of 5 to 10 this system offers compact, centralized storage, accessible from anywhere.
